WebbDescription. A robustly built species with a streamlined "typical shark" form, the blacktip reef shark has a short, wide, rounded snout and moderately large, oval eyes. Each nostril has a flap of skin in front that is expanded into a nipple-shaped lobe. Not counting small symphysial (central) teeth, the tooth rows number 11–13 (usually 12) on ... Free for commercial use High Quality Images WebbThe ZICKERT Shark™ Bottom Sludge Scraper has over 3,000 installations all over the world, 90 percent of which are retrofits. It is designed for continuous sludge transport and performs well in all sedimentation processes, including grit chambers. The scraper can be powered by a hydraulic or electric drive.

Webb19 maj 2024 · Horn Shark Size. The Horn Shark is a small species of shark, with an average length of approximately 2 feet. Horn Sharks are found in the coastal waters of the eastern Pacific Ocean, from California to Peru. Horn Sharks are bottom-dwellers, and prefer rocky reefs and kelp forests as their habitat. Webb20 aug. 2024 · Rainbow sharks are bottom feeders, which will eat algae both faster and in larger quantities than the red tail shark. Because of their diet, the red tail and rainbow shark occupy different water levels. The red tail shark often inhabits the middle water level, with dips to the bottom level. The rainbow shark, on the other hand, prefers the bottom.

Webb12 juli 2024 · An ambush predator, the shark – which can reach 2.5 metres in length – spends much of its time submerged in seafloor sand, waiting for prey to swim overhead. The bottom-dwelling angelshark is today much rarer in British waters than even a few decades ago. The sand tiger shark ( Carcharias taurus ), gray nurse shark, spotted ragged-tooth shark or blue-nurse sand tiger, is a species of shark that inhabits subtropical and temperate waters worldwide. Most sharks have eight fins: a pair of pectoral fins, a pair of pelvic fins, two dorsal fins, an anal fin, and a caudal fin. Pectoral fins are stiff, which enables downward movement, lift and guidance. The members of the order Hexanchiformes have only a single dorsal fin.
